Two Intel® 82571GB Gigabit Controllers
|
Enables four Gigabit Ethernet connections on a single adapter, delivering increased bandwidth for slot-constrained servers
and providing high performance, reliability, and low-power use in two integrated, dual port PCI Express Gigabit Ethernet
controller chips |
|
Load balancing on multiple CPUs
|
Increases performance on multi-processor systems by efficiently balancing network loads across CPU cores when used with
Receive-Side Scaling from Microsoft or Scalable I/O on Linux* |
|
Intel® I/OAT
2
|
Accelerates I/O with higher throughput and lower CPU utilization by offloading processing overhead |
|
Virtualization
|
Multi-port cards provide the platform with the port density required for virtualized environments |
|
LC connectors
|
Small connector design is compatible with the latest fiber-optic cabling standards |
|
1000BASE-SX multi-mode fiber
|
Ensures compatibility with fiber-optic cable lengths up to 275 meters |
|
Support for most network operating systems (NOS)
|
Enables widespread deployment |
|
Remote management support
|
Reduces support costs with remote management based on industry-wide standards |
|
RoHS compliant
3, lead-free1technology |
Compliant with the European Union directive (effective as of July 2006) to reduce the use of hazardous materials |
|
Intel® PROSet Utility for Windows*
|
Provides point-and-click power over individual adapters, advanced adapter features, connection teaming, and Device Manager
virtual local area network (VLAN) configuration |
|
Advanced cable diagnostics
|
Dynamically tests and reports network problems (error rate, cable length) and automatically compensates for cable issues (cross-over cable, wrong pin-out/polarity) |
